第3章 MySQL数据库管理
一、选择题
1.下列()不能作用MySQL数据库名。 A.minrisoftB.mingrisoft_01C.com$com 2.下列描述错误的是().
A.在Windows系统中,可以创建一个名称为tb_bookInfo的数据库和一个名称为tb_bookinfo的数据库。 B.MySQL数据库名可以由任意字母、阿拉伯数字、下划线(_)和“$\"组成. C.MySQL数据库名最长可为个字符。 D.不能使用MySQL关键字作为数据库名、表名。 3.下列()语句不是创建数据库的语句。 A.CREATE SCHEMAB.CREATE DATABASE C.CREATE TABLE
4.下列()语句可以用于查看服务器中所有的数据库名称. A.SHOW DATABASE;B.SHOW DATABASES; C.SHOWENGINES;D.SHOWVARIABLES;
5.在MySQL中,可以使用()语句查询MySQL中支持的存储引擎。 A.SHOW DATABASE;B.SHOW DATABASES; C.SHOW ENGINES;
D.SHOWVARIABLES;
6.在MySQL中,可以使用()语句查看MySQL服务器采用的默认存储引擎。 A.SHOW DATABASE;B.SHOW DATABASES; C.SHOW ENGINES; A.InnoDB
D.SHOWVARIABLES;
C.MEMORY D.以上都是
7.下列()存储引擎下的表被存储成3个文件。
B.MyISAM
8.下列关于修改数据库描述错误的是( ). A.使用ALTER DATABASE语句可以修改数据库名。
B.使用ALTER DATABASE的CHARACTER SET选项可以修改数据的字符集。 C.使用ALTER DATABASE的COLLATE选项可以指定字符集的校对规则。 D.使用ALTER DATABASE语句时可以不指定数据库名称。 9.SHOW ENGINES语句不可以用( )结束。 A.“;\"
B.“\\g\"
C.“\\G”
D.“\\;”
10.下列( )语句可以用于将db_library数据库作为当前默认的数据库。 A.CREATE DATABASEdb_libraryB.SHOW db_library; C.USE db_library;D.SELECT db_library;
D.20170609
二、填空题
1.使用___________________或者___________________语句可以轻松创建MySQL数据库。
25
MySQL教材 2.在创建数据库时,可以使用__________________选项来实现在创建数据库前判断该数据库是否存在. 3.在创建数据库时,可以使用___________________选项来指定数据库所使用的字符集。
4.成功创建数据库后,可以使用___________________命令查看MySQL服务器中的所有数据库信息。 5.MySQL中可以使用______________语句选择一个数据库,使其成为当前默认数据库。。 6.修改数据库可以使用___________________或者___________________语句来实现. 7.删除数据库的操作可以使用______________________语句。
8.在MySQL中,可以使用____________________________语句查询MySQL中支持的存储引擎。 9.可以通过执行__________________________命令来查看当前MySQL服务器采用的默认存储引擎。 10.MySQL有多个可用的存储引擎,常用的有_____________、_____________和_____________3种。
26